Obituary for Earline Stansell

A Memorial Visitation for Earline Stansell, 87, of Chandler is scheduled for Thursday, April 29, 2021 from 4-7:00 p.m. at the Rock Hill Youth Building, 10768 CR 3405, Brownsboro, Texas 75756.

Ms. Stansell departed this life in the early hours of April 26, 2021 in Chandler, Texas.

Gloria Earline (Houston) Stansell was born December 14, 1933 in Wood County, Texas, the daughter of Earl Clifford Houston and Gladys Ozell (Crone) Houston. She was raised in Waco, Texas along with her three sisters- Joyce Janet (Houston) Daily, Wanda Faye (Houston) Hughes and Charlotte Annett (Houston) Anderson. She lived in Fort Worth for many years with her late husband, J.B. Stansell, and her late daughter, Pamela Susanne (Whit) Moore. After Pam’s passing, she helped raise her granddaughter, Cynthia L. (Moore) Kumar, who now resides in the UK with her husband Vik Kumar and their three sons. Always self-sufficient, she supported herself, her daughter and granddaughter with many years of hard work. She will be missed and forever loved in the hearts of those that knew her.

She is preceded in death by her parents; husband, J.B. Stansell; daughter, Pamela Susanne (Whit) Moore and sister, Wanda.

Earline is survived by sisters, Joyce and Charlotte as well as many affectionate nieces and nephews.

Funeral arrangements were entrusted to the Chandler Memorial Funeral Home family.
